Ben Galbraith
Book author, Ajaxian-at-Large, and Consultant
Ben Galbraith is a frequent technical speaker, occasional consultant, and author of several Java-related books. He is a co-founder of Ajaxian.com, an experienced CTO and Java Architect, and is presently a consultant specializing in Java Swing and Ajax development. Ben wrote his first computer program when he was six years old, started his first business at ten, and entered the IT workforce just after turning twelve. For the past few years, he’s been professionally coding in Java. Ben has delivered hundreds of technical presentations world-wide at venues including JavaOne, The Ajax Experience, JavaPolis, and the No Fluff Just Stuff Java Symposium series; he was the top-rated speaker at JavaOne 2006.

Making the Most of XML
For many of us, XML has become a ubiquitous presence in application development, whether parsing, validating, or manipulating it. For many of us, all that XML is coupled with pain, in the form of tedious APIs (like, say, the W3C DOM API) and confusing technologies (oh, I don't know, W3C XML Schema?).
In this session, I share the following tips for making the XML in our lives a little easier to deal with: - Use StAX instead of SAX - Use StAX to create XML - Use JDOM instead of W3C DOM - Use XPath to select XML - Use Jaxen to enable XPath over custom trees - Use RELAX NG instead of DTD or WXS - Use Trang when DTD/WXS output is required - Use Sun's RELAX NG Converter when WXS input is required - Consider RELAX NG's compact syntax - Use Schematron to extend schema languages - Consider XML namespaces for versioning - Ignore unknown namespaces
Creating Polished Swing Applications
Too often, Swing applications are slow, ugly, and hard-to-maintain. It turns out that it doesn't have to be this way. Swing can be used to create highly-responsive, beautiful applications that are very maintainable. If this isn't consistent with your own experience, don't feel bad; its not very obvious how to make Swing sing.
In this session, I explore three topics that lead to much better Swing applications:
- Proper Swing threading
- High-quality third-party Swing look-and-feels
- Good practices for coding Swing applications
In the threading portion of the session, I explain Swing's event handling architecture and its implications for Swing applications. Understanding this topic is crucial to creating highly-responsive Swing apps. I demonstrate how to use this knowledge in the form of many live-coded examples, and I show how frameworks like SwingWorker and FoxTrot can make this easier. Java's default look-and-feel, Metal, is awful (and in my opinion, the "Ocean" theme in JDK 5.0 doesn't do enough to improve it); you should stop using it immediately. But creating good-looking applications is sadly more than slapping in a look-and-feel; you must also take care to understand the principles behind attractive layouts. I spend the second part of this session exploring how to make your Swing applications look great through a combination of third-party look-and-feels and layout techniques.

Introduction to Ajax
Ajax -- called DHTML just a few months ago -- has revolutionized (or "radically iterated", if you like) web application development in the short few months since the term was coined.
What is it all about? Why are we excited about a set of capabilites that have been sitting in our browser for years? What can you do with it? And, how can you do it?
Ajax, short for Asynchronous JavaScript and XML, is a technique for communicating with servers from within a web page without causing a page refresh.
This session provides an introduction to Ajax and an orientation to the state of the ajaxian universe. The basic ajaxian techniques will be demonstrated through live coding, and more advanced examples of Ajax will be demonstrated and deconstructed.
Attendees will understand how the Google Maps UI is built (and why it isn't as hard as it looks), how Ajax can improve portals, community sites, and pretty much any other type of web application.
Furthermore, the issues surrounding how to create an Ajax application that doesn't turn into an unmaintainable pile of hacked up crap JavaScript will be discussed.
At the end of the session, an off-line capable, web services consuming Ajax RSS aggregator will also be demonstrated.

Creating Killer Graphics and Professional PDFs with XML
You can do some pretty cool things with XML these days (despite what some curmudgeons in the technology world may claim). In the past few years, XML has solidified its place as the lingua franca of data sharing and data manipulation. But XML as a data transfer language is only marginally interesting. Things get really exciting when XML is dynamically transformed into other formats. In this session, I focus on two XML formats which can be readily transformed into high-quality presentation-centric output formats. XSL-FO is a typesetting format for XML that can be readily converted into PDF (or Postscript and some other formats). SVG is a vector graphics language in XML -- a sort of open-source version of the popular Macromedia Flash format. SVG files can be converted into beautiful, completely scalable -- and interactive - - images.

Being Productive with Java in the Enterprise
It sounded like such a good idea back in the mid-nineties: based the Java platform on a standards-based, open community, and let anyone participate. There is no question that Sun's strategy for Java's stewardship via the JCP and sponsored open-source has yielded some enormous benefits. However, these have not been enjoyed without tremendous cost.
Perhaps the recent pop-culture book The Paradox of Choice put it best: "When people have no choice, life is almost unbearable. As the number of available choices increases, [as it has in the Java community], the autonomy, control, and liberation this variety brings are powerful and positive. But as the number of choices keeps growing, negative aspects of having a multitude of options begin to appear. as the number of choices grows further, the negatives escalate until we become overloaded. At this point, choice no longer liberates, but debilitates. It might even be said to tyrannize."
Does this ring true in your environment? Are you tired of spending countless hours evaluating IDEs, build systems, app server vendors, competing web frameworks, competing persistence standards, competing vendor implementations of those standards, and so forth? You're not alone.
The mess of competing standards, implementations, and other overlapping non-standard frameworks in Java, and lack of a single authoritative vendor-guide (i.e., Sun's "guidance" has proved irrelevant and unproductive) kills Java's productivity for all but a handful of experts with the experience to navigate the landscape.
This session details the ideas and experiences of one enterprise that has set out to solve this problem. The topics reviewed will consists of:
Defining a standard "stack" of Java frameworks and technologies, but also "standardizing on demand"
Creating a template application that acts as the starting point for any new project
Approaching reuse retrospectively, not prospectively
Unifying training and support, and providing organization mentoring
Simple project health monitoring
Of course, the idea of standardizing application development in an organization is nothing new. You may have tried it. Did it work? Being successful at this endeavor is tricky, and most efforts fail.
While the specific example detailed in this session is still underway and its too early to declare unqualified success, come learn about this effort and how its principles can be applied in your organization.
